> How do I go about fixing this?
>
This looks more of an Ubuntu issue. Sign up for the
ubuntu-users at lists.ubuntu.com mailing list, and post the entire output
(including the commands that you type) of "sudo apt-get install wine"
and "cat /etc/apt/sources.list"to that list.
